1. Transcribe Your Video for Written Content
Use transcription tools like:
Otter.ai
Descript
YouTube’s auto captions
Once transcribed, you have the raw material to create:
Blog posts
Captions
Social media quotes
2. Turn It into a Blog Post
Take your transcription and structure it into a readable, SEO-optimized blog. Add:
Subheadings
Bullet points
Screenshots or key visuals from the video
Don’t forget to embed the YouTube video in the blog itself to boost watch time.
3. Extract Short Clips for Reels/Shorts
Use video editing tools like CapCut, Premiere Pro, VN App to extract short clips (15–60 seconds) from your video:
Tips
Quotes
Reactions
These are perfect for:Instagram Reels
Facebook Stories
TikTok
YouTube Shorts
One 10-minute video can easily give you 5–10 short clips.
4. Create Instagram Carousels
Take the main points from your video and convert them into a carousel post on Instagram or LinkedIn:
Slide 1: Hook/Question
Slide 2–5: Tips or insights
Final Slide: Call to action — “Watch the full video on YouTube!”
Use tools like Canva or Figma for quick design.
5. Make a Pinterest Pin
Design a vertical graphic (1000x1500 px) with your YouTube video thumbnail, a catchy title, and a CTA. Link it to your blog or directly to the video.
This can bring long-term traffic from Pinterest.
6. Write a LinkedIn Post
Write a mini case study or insight thread based on your video topic. You can say:
“In my latest YouTube video, I covered 3 ways to grow on Instagram in 2025. Here’s a quick summary…”
Add value and then link to the full video in the comments.
7. Extract Key Quotes
Pull 3–4 powerful or interesting sentences from your video and turn them into:
Quote graphics
Twitter/X posts
Instagram text-based stories
Example:
“You don’t need more followers. You need better engagement.”
8. Create an Email Newsletter
Write a short, engaging email to your audience:
What the video is about
Why it’s useful
Link to watch
This keeps your subscribers informed and brings them back to your content.
9. Turn the Video into a Slide Deck
If your video is educational or informative, convert the key points into a slide deck. Share on:
LinkedIn
SlideShare
Internal training
You can even offer it as a downloadable resource on your site.
10. Repurpose as an Audio Podcast
Extract the audio and upload it as a podcast episode using tools like:
Anchor
Buzzsprout
Podbean
Many users prefer listening over watching. This method gives you another audience.
